Paris Fashion Week Continues With Couture

The haute couture edition of Paris Fashion Week Spring/Summer 2010– reserved for an elite minority of designer houses which have won an official stamp of approval from the French government, kicks off this week following the men’s ready-to-wear shows last week. Fashionistas and celebrities are thronging to the runways to see new collections from British designer John Galliano (for Christian Dior), whimsical French créateur Jean Paul Gaultier, and a line from rising couture star Anne Valérie Hash which employs recycled garments from classic designers. Unless you’re loafing around in one of Paris’ top fashion districts or attempting to ogle actors and models at the ultraposh Hotel Costes this week, you’re unlikely to notice the whiff of champagne and luxury cell phones on the air (Versace is reportedly gearing up to show off a prototype for the latter at one of the shows this week– an invention which should make the world infinitely more useful).
